Common Myths Concerning LASIK and PRK



Many individuals have misunderstandings about LASIK and PRK that can shadow their decision-making. One typical myth is that these procedures are just for those with severe vision issues. In truth, LASIK and PRK can deal with a series of refractive errors, including nearsightedness, farsightedness, and astigmatism.

An additional misconception is the idea that the surgical procedures are painful. Most people experience very little pain during the process, thanks to numbing eye decreases. Some could additionally stress over a prolonged recuperation; nevertheless, numerous go back to their day-to-day tasks within a day or more.

Additionally, there's a mistaken belief that when you have the surgery, you'll never ever need glasses once again. While several accomplish 20/20 vision, some might still require glasses for specific tasks as they age.

Long-Term Outcomes and Considerations for Clients



As you take into consideration the lasting outcomes of vision modification surgical treatment, it's essential to understand just how your eyesight might change gradually. Many individuals experience stable vision for several years after the procedure, but some may notice progressive shifts because of age or other factors.

Routine eye exams are important to check these adjustments and ensure your vision continues to be optimal. It's additionally crucial to go over any type of concerns with your eye expert, as they can provide support tailored to your special circumstance.



While many patients appreciate enhanced vision, you should be gotten ready for the possibility of needing glasses or get in touch with lenses later on in life.
